Google Nexus 5 Smartphone Rumours

Specs of web giant's next-gen device reportedly leaked...

Googleis reported to be considering prototypes for a planned Nexus 5 smartphone.
The web search leviathan has already enjoyed major success with its Nexus 7 and Nexus 10 tablets, and now Android And Me website has obtained what it claims is concept artwork for the phone handset, which will be created by LG.
Apparently codenamed Megalodon, the device is claimed to feature a 5.2-inch 1920x1080 OLED display and be powered by 2.3 G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on 800 - with 3GB of RAM.
It also apparently has a 16-megapixel rear camera from OmniVision, with a 2.1-megapixel camera mounted on the front of the device.
The handset spec also mentions a 3300 mAh lithium polymer battery and it will incorporate speakers for stereo sound.
No launch date has been mooted and no official announcement has been made, but Google was expected to update its phone and tablet offerings this year when the next version of Android is unveiled.
